Locating The Sleep Timer Feature On Your Tv

To locate the sleep timer feature on your TV, you will first need to grab the remote control that came with your television. The sleep timer functionality is typically found within the settings or menu options of your TV. On most TV remotes, you can access the settings menu by pressing the “Menu” button.

Once you have accessed the settings menu, navigate through the options using the arrow keys on your remote until you find the “Sleep Timer” feature. This option is commonly located under the “System” or “Timer” category. Select the “Sleep Timer” option and you will be able to set a specific time duration for your TV to automatically shut off. You can usually choose from preset time intervals or input a custom time period using the numerical keypad on your remote.

Once you have selected the desired sleep timer duration, remember to confirm or save your settings as per the instructions on your TV screen. This feature is convenient for ensuring that your TV turns off after a set period, helping you conserve energy and enjoy a peaceful night’s sleep.

Setting A Sleep Timer On Various Tv Brands

Setting a sleep timer on your TV may vary depending on the brand of television you own. Each brand has its own unique interface and menu options for setting a sleep timer. For Samsung TVs, navigate to the Settings menu, select General, then choose Eco Solution, and finally, set the Sleep Timer option to your desired timeframe. LG TV owners can access the Timer option from the Quick Menu and adjust the sleep timer accordingly.

If you have a Sony TV, locate the Clock/Timers option in the Settings menu, choose Sleep Timer, and set the timer duration. For Vizio TVs, go to the System menu, select Timers, and then Sleep Timer to set the desired time for automatic shut-off. Panasonic TVs typically have the Sleep Timer option under the Setup menu for easy access.

Troubleshooting Common Issues With Sleep Timers

When it comes to using sleep timers on your TV, there are some common issues that may arise. One frequent problem is the timer not activating as expected, which can occur due to incorrect settings or software glitches. To troubleshoot this, double-check your timer settings to ensure they are input correctly, and consider restarting your TV to reset any potential glitches.

Another common issue with sleep timers is when the TV shuts off at the designated time but then immediately turns back on. This may be caused by a power surge or interference from other electronic devices nearby. To address this, try plugging your TV into a different outlet or using a surge protector to stabilize the power source.

Lastly, if your sleep timer is not working at all or consistently experiencing issues, it may be a sign of a deeper underlying problem with your TV’s hardware or software. In such cases, contacting the manufacturer’s customer support or seeking professional assistance may be necessary to diagnose and resolve the issue effectively.

Alternative Methods For Managing Your Tv’S Sleep Feature

If your TV does not have a built-in sleep timer feature or if you’re looking for alternative methods for managing your TV’s sleep function, there are several options available. One simple solution is to use a smart plug or outlet timer that can be programmed to automatically turn off your TV at a set time each night. This way, you can still enjoy falling asleep to your favorite shows without worrying about the TV running all night.

Another method is to use a universal remote control that comes with a sleep timer function. These remotes can be programmed to work with multiple devices, including your TV, making it easy to set a sleep timer without having to rely on the TV’s built-in features. Additionally, some streaming devices or set-top boxes also come with sleep timer capabilities that can help you manage the power-off function of your TV.

Lastly, if all else fails, you can manually set a timer on an external device, such as a smartphone or tablet, to remind you to turn off your TV at a specific time each night. While these alternative methods may require a bit more setup or external devices, they can be useful solutions for managing your TV’s sleep feature effectively.

Are All Tvs Equipped With A Built-In Sleep Timer Feature?

Not all TVs are equipped with a built-in sleep timer feature. While many modern televisions come with this convenient function that allows users to set a time for the TV to automatically turn off, it is not a universal feature across all models. Some older or basic TV sets may not have this functionality included, requiring manual switching off by the user. It is always advisable to check the specifications of a TV model if the sleep timer feature is important to you.
